In the Old Town are dozens of old, narrow streets and alleys. These alleys and narrow streets were once bustling with residence and work. Some have been preserved over 400 years, and are part of the city's cultural heritage. Some have been redeveloped and include newer restaurants, bars, and shops.

There are a few points that all new drivers should be aware of prior to taking the road test. For example, you need to know the Highway Code and understand the meaning of various road signs. You should also study the guide and watch videos on how to operate in a car.

You can also opt for the Pass Plus course. This will provide you with additional training and will help you become an experienced and safer driver. The course isn't required but it can save you money on insurance premiums. Most driving schools offer this service at a cost.
